| ## What is a channel | ||||
| 
 | ||||
| In simple terms a lightning channel is a money tube that allows fast, cheap and private transfers of money without sending transactions to the blockchain.  | ||||
| More technically a channel is a 2-of-2 multisignature bitcoin onchain transaction that establishes a financial relationship between two agents without trust. | ||||
| As we seen in [§6.1:Sending a transaction to a multisig](06_1_Sending_a_Transaction_to_a_Multisig.md) chapter multisignatures are generally described as being "m of n". That means that the transaction is locked with a group of "n" keys, but only "m" of them are required to unlock the transaction.    | ||||
| 
 | ||||
| Channels on the Lightning Network always are created between two nodes. The channel mantains a local database with bitcoin balance for both parts keeping track of how much money they each have. | ||||
| 
 | ||||

| #### Fund you c-lightning wallet. | ||||
| 
 | ||||
| The first thing you need to do is send some satoshis to your c-lightning wallet.  You can create a new address using this command an send it money.  This is done with the `lightning-cli newaddr` command. The newaddr RPC command generates a new address which can subsequently be used to fund channels managed by the c-lightning node.  This transaction is called the [funding transaction](https://github.com/lightningnetwork/lightning-rfc/blob/master/03-transactions.md#funding-transaction-output) and it needs to be confirmed before funds can be used.  You can specify the type of address wanted,  if not specified the address generated will be a bench32. | ||||
| 
 | ||||
| ``` | ||||
| $ lightning-cli --network=testnet newaddr | ||||
| { | ||||
|    "address": "tb1qefule33u7ukfuzkmxpz02kwejl8j8dt5jpgtu6", | ||||
|    "bech32": "tb1qefule33u7ukfuzkmxpz02kwejl8j8dt5jpgtu6" | ||||
| } | ||||
| ```        | ||||
